UK Baseball wins, sweeps Akron

by @ 5:49 pm. Filed under Blue Blooded Opinions

Corey Littrell

 

The UK Baseball team won again today, beating Akron 9-2, and locking up the three-game series sweep of the Zips. Lefty Corey Littrell made his third start of the year, and was impressive from start to finish. The Louisville native gave the Cats seven strong innings, striking out eight, while only allowing one hit. Austin Cousino hit a three-run bomb in the second, and A.J. Reed added 3 RBI’s of his own on a bases clearing double in the fourth. Overall, it was a strong performance for the No. 8 Cats, who improve to 10-1 on the year. 

 

Pay attention to this team, boys and girls. They’re very, very good. Next game is Tuesday at 4PM versus Cincinnati at Cliff Hagan Stadium.
